Hi - great site and congrats to all for the obvious passion that's gone into it.
Just a little pick - in the Welcome note you mention that there's no 'kill-shot' in squash. That's not even debateable. The nick (floor/wall) is frequently used to finish rallies - anything from a delicate drop to full-blooded cross-court volley. It rolls, clearly unplayable, looks great and 'kill-shot' by any definition.
Could use a little re-write for the sake of accuracy.
